Flow Pattern Identification About Fluid Flow Based On The Terahertz Time-domain Spectroscopy

Single-phase flow and multiphase flow widely exists in the oil field,petrochemical,nuclear and aerospace industries,and flow pattern-the trajectory of fluid particle,the distribution of velocity or the geometric distribution of fluid particle,etc-are the very important flow parameters,which affect the mechanical properties and the characteristics of the heat and mass transfer of the flow.So the study of flow pattern,especially the judgment of the flow pattern change,is the basic studying of the fluid flow.In this paper,method of optical detection will be adopted,basing on the change of the THz time-domain spectrum characteristics,to study the flow pattern of single phase flow and different water content of oil & water two-phase flow with different flow rates in horizontal pipe.The main contents and conclusions of this paper:(1)Single-phase flow medium,composition by light diesel oil,is detected and analyzed by THz time-domain spectroscopy under different flow rates in horizontal pipe which was made by special material.The results shows that the flow rate-time domain spectrum peak value curve,which was made from THz time-domain spectroscopy,has obvious turning point.With the judgment of Reynolds number,it shows that the turning point of the curve is the flow pattern transition point.Therefore,the THz time-domain spectroscopy can be used to study the transition of flow pattern about the single-phase flow.(2)Light diesel oil & water mixtures with different water content,in which water was dispersed phase and light diesel oil was the continuous phase,were detected and analyzed by THz time-domain spectroscopy under different flow rates in horizontal pipe which was made by special material.Also the results shows that all flow rate-time domain spectrum peak value curves,which were made from THz time-domain spectroscopy,have obvious turning point.According to the characteristics of the corresponding graph of single phase flow and basing on the analysis of experimental results,it can be sure that the turning points of the curves are the flow pattern transition of the oil & water two phase flow.Therefore,THz time domain spectroscopy can be used to study the flow pattern transition of the oil & water two phase flow,or even the flow pattern transition of the multiphase flow.To some extent,of course,this two phase flow experiment may have laid a solid foundation for using THz time-domain spectroscopy to further study the flow pattern or the phase transformation of two phase flow or even the multiphase flow in the future.
